Sheet View allows users to sort and filter the data they need, and then select an option to make those changes visible just to themselves or to everyone working in the document. Once selecting to make changes just for yourself, that filter and sort will not affect other collaborators\u2019 view of the workbook. All your cell level edits propagate through the file regardless of your view, so you can make all your edits right in your personal Sheet View. Now Microsoft Forms enables you to allow users to include file uploads. With this new feature, you can easily create a resume collection form, a claim form, or a photography competition form. To get started, click the drop-down menu to add advanced question types and select <strong>File upload<\/strong>. Once you successfully add a file upload question, a folder will be automatically created in your OneDrive or SharePoint.<\/p>\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/www.sickgaming.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2019\/11\/whats-new-to-microsoft-365-in-november-customize-excel-track-notes-in-outlook-and-more-3.gif\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"alignnone wp-image-233694 size-full\" src=\"https:\/\/www.sickgaming.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2019\/11\/whats-new-to-microsoft-365-in-november-customize-excel-track-notes-in-outlook-and-more-3.gif\" alt=\"Animated image of a file being uploaded in Microsoft Forms.\" width=\"1280\" height=\"720\"><\/a><\/p>\n<h3>The new Productivity Score, simplified licensing, and the latest Windows 10 release<\/h3>\n<p>New capabilities to help you transform workplace productivity, tap into the power of the cloud, and simplify licensing.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Transform how work gets done with insights from Microsoft Productivity Score<\/strong>\u2014At Ignite, we <a href=\"https:\/\/aka.ms\/productivityscoreblog\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\">announced Productivity Score<\/a> to help deliver visibility into how your organization works.
